Skip to content
Crazy Carrot

Crazy Carrot

4.8 xStar (1,000+)6081.6 kmHealthyVegetarianSaladsGroup FriendlyInfo

xDelivery bag remove Delivery unavailable

Tap for hours, info, and more

30 Wyndham St N

xTag $0 delivery fee

new customers

Delivery unavailable

Delivery time

Sunday

12:00 p.m. - 4:45 p.m.

Monday - Saturday

11:00 a.m. - 8:45 p.m.

Menu

11:00 AM – 8:45 PM

Search